Output 2b0c61eeaa78b636fdaa18506899cb52303cb832780849454e278c2aeb0294f5:0

value
1654992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84fef37fcb5d1afd58792ef8e6fe0a91c73e7736 OP_EQUAL
address
3DpEYBaHj6ehXLiPVp5ge36up1Ebi1kj4B
transaction
2b0c61eeaa78b636fdaa18506899cb52303cb832780849454e278c2aeb0294f5